Saya seorang mahasiswa dan saya sedang mengembangkan beberapa proyek sebagai bagian dari akademisi saya.
Saat mengembangkan database untuk salah satu proyek, kami menemukan situasi di mana kami memikirkan apakah ERD diperlukan atau tidak. Saat ini, tidak semua dari kita sepakat untuk mengembangkan ERD terlebih dahulu, dan kemudian mengembangkan database darinya.
Mayoritas orang lebih suka mengembangkan database dengan cepat sesuai dengan persyaratan sistem dan langsung di atas kertas.
Sekarang, saya adalah pengikut ketat prinsip-prinsip Database. Saya pikir database harus dikembangkan dari ERD saja. Jadi, saya hanya ingin tahu yang berikut:
- Apakah industri mengikuti prinsip-prinsip ini?
- Apakah saya hanya membuang-buang waktu untuk mengembangkan ERD?
- Apa manfaat mengembangkan ERD?